BBQ pizza with artichoke hearts, olives and Haloumi cheese
- Preparation 2 h 30 min
- Cooking 10 min
- Servings 4
- Freezing Absolutely

Ingredients for the dough
- 1 1/4 cups warm water
- 2 tablespoons sugar
- 2 tablespoons traditional active dry yeast
- 2 1/2 cups unbleached all-purpose flour + a bit for kneading
- 1/2 cup durum wheat semolina
- 1 teaspoon salt
Ingredients
- Olive oil
- Provence herbs
- 320g Haloumi cheese (rinsed 30 seconds under cold water), diced
- 4 garlic cloves, minced very finely
- 1 dry pint (551ml) grape tomatoes, cut in half
- 398ml artichoke hearts, very well drained and hard leaves removed, cut in half or in quarters
- 250ml pitted giant green olives, cut in half
- A nice handful fresh basil, roughly chopped
- Ground pepper

Preparation
- Start with the pizza dough. In a bowl, add the water, sugar and yeast then mix well to dissolve. Set aside for about 6-7 minutes, a foam should form on top.
- In a large bowl, combine the semolina, flour and salt. Add the liquid preparation to the dry ingredients and mix well.
- With your hands, form a ball and knead for 5 minutes, until it is smooth and does not stick to the work surface. Add flour from time to time to make it easy.
- Form a ball and place the dough in a large bowl lightly coated with olive oil.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and let it srisewell on the counter for 1 hour.
- Remove the plastic wrap and with your fist, punch the dough to remove the air. Reform a ball. Cover and let rise for another hour.
- Remove the film then remove the air from the dough with your fist again. Separate the ball in half, flour, then roll down to obtain two medium pizzas. Set aside.
- Preheat the BBQ to maximum intensity and reduce to medium intensity.
- Thoroughly flour the top of your pizza dough and place this side directly on the hot grills. Close lid and cook for about 2 minutes, or until dough is well marked. Remove from heat and place on a wire rack.
- Preheat the BBQ at maximum intensity.
- Add a thin stream of olive oil on the grilled side and spread well with a brush. Sprinkle with Provence herbs to taste.
- Spread the Haloumi cheese, garlic, grape tomatoes, artichoke hearts, green olives and fresh basil on both pizzas. Pepper to taste.
- Close a BBQ fire and gently slide the pizzas on the closed side. Close the lid and continue cooking for 6 to 8 minutes, or until the dough is cooked and the Haloumi cheese is soft. The cubes will not melt completely and that’s normal. Cut into pieces and serve immediately!
